Since we started Alfie’s Lake, we have actually only been able to share positive stories. This week has changed that. Nature is beyond our control.
Jon, Jason, and Dale arrived on Saturday. The night before they arrived, a tree fell down…was this a bad omen? Otherwise, good weather was forecast and there wasn't a cloud in the sky…but no one had anticipated tropical temperatures up to 38 degrees. As a result, the fish were completely uninterested and the lake was essentially at a standstill. Due to the high temperatures, the fish also started spawning for the third time.
On top of that, today one of our large commons floated to the surface, as she couldn't get rid of her eggs. Jon, Jason, and Dale massaged the fish all day to get the eggs out…but unfortunately, we just received the news that she didn't make it. Hopefully, many little ones will carry on this beautiful bloodline.
This week will remain etched in our memory, due to the unfortunate laws of nature, but also thanks to the help of the fishermen who had expected more from this week anyway... unfortunately, this is also part of fishing and running a fishing lake....
